Output 58005680fcfb6c89874ac76d3979720f277b62bcc5d18475eb2a91128332a574:1

value
1757236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c6de4b16baa5c138c2cb19548a0244f5a0cfd87 OP_EQUALVERIFY OP_CHECKSIG
address
16WXC2t292LkT6Yepxuz6GUoHvi9bR66gR
transaction
58005680fcfb6c89874ac76d3979720f277b62bcc5d18475eb2a91128332a574
spent
true